Aquino to the Bullpen
During a long awaited off day, I had a regular meeting with Mr. Stuart and Mgr. Machado. During some recent soul searching I came to the realization that I should pass off the reigns of setting the rotation and the rosters to Machado, after all that is what he was hired to do and my tinkering has only gotten us to a .500 mark. This should also help improve my relationship with Machado who, not surprisingly, hasn't been thrilled with me getting involved.
The first item on Machado's list was to move Aquino from the starting rotation into the closer role and place Jennings into the #5 slot. Needless to say this raised some eyebrows, even though Davies has been telling me since I took over that Aquino should be moved to pen. It was more surprising given that Aquino is fresh off his third pitcher of the year award. Given Aquino's popularity and status with the club, we didn't want to make this move without consulting him. I was somewhat surprised that he was very receptive to the move. So effective immediately Aquino will be the Mallards closer, moving Howell to the set up position and Jennings into the starting rotation. I have a couple solid prospects in the minors; but I don't think they will be ready to move up this season, so hopefully between Jennings and Baca we can manage the 5th spot. |
